什么是ChartDB?
ChartDB是一款强大、免费且开源的数据库可视化与设计平台,用户可通过一次查询快速导入数据库结构,并生成清晰、可定制的ER图。支持PostgreSQL、MySQL、SQLite、SQL Server、MariaDB、ClickHouse和CockroachDB等主流关系型及分析型数据库。ChartDB支持结构编辑、关系管理,并提供AI辅助的多方言SQL DDL脚本导出,简化数据库迁移与文档编制流程。适用于开发者、数据分析师和工程师,ChartDB既可作为云服务,也可自托管,强调易用性、协作性和可扩展性。
主要功能
即时导入数据库结构
只需一次智能查询,即可瞬间获取并可视化整个数据库结构,支持多种数据库类型。
AI驱动的SQL导出
生成多种SQL方言的准确DDL脚本,轻松实现数据库迁移和部署。
交互式图表编辑器
自定义ER图,支持撤销/重做、表与关系管理、布局、颜色和注释等功能。
广泛的数据库支持
兼容主流关系型和分析型数据库,包括PostgreSQL、MySQL、SQLite、SQL Server、MariaDB、ClickHouse和CockroachDB。
开源与自托管
完全开源,可本地或私有部署,保障数据隐私与高度可定制性。
便捷分享与协作
可将图表导出为图片、JSON、DBML或SQL脚本,便于团队高效共享精美且精准的数据库文档。
1. ChartDB支持哪些数据库?⌄
ChartDB支持PostgreSQL、MySQL、SQLite、SQL Server、MariaDB、ClickHouse和CockroachDB。
2. ChartDB如何导入数据库结构?⌄
每个数据库只需一次智能查询,即可瞬间获取整个结构并以JSON形式可视化。
3. 可以将我的图表导出为其他格式吗?⌄
可以,您可以将图表导出为SQL DDL脚本、图片、JSON和DBML文件。
4. ChartDB是否免费?⌄
可以,ChartDB是一款免费且开源的工具。
5. ChartDB支持AI相关功能吗?⌄
支持,ChartDB内置AI驱动的SQL导出,可生成适用于不同SQL方言的迁移脚本。
6. 可以自托管ChartDB吗?⌄
完全可以,ChartDB支持本地或私有服务器部署,保障完全控制。
7. 使用ChartDB需要注册账号吗?⌄
使用ChartDB核心功能无需注册账号。
